Origins in Memes and Humor


Dogecoin was created in 2013 by software engineers Billy Markus and Jackson Palmer as a playful parody of the then-booming cryptocurrency market. They combined the popular "doge" meme, featuring a Shiba Inu dog with broken English, with blockchain technology. The result was Dogecoin, a cryptocurrency designed to be fun and easy to use.

Building a Community


Dogecoin's lighthearted nature quickly attracted a loyal community of supporters. Social media platforms like Reddit and Twitter became hubs for Doge enthusiasts, who shared memes, discussed the cryptocurrency's potential, and engaged in various community activities. The Dogecoin community embraced the coin's playful spirit, making it one of the most approachable and welcoming cryptocurrency communities.

Elon Musk's Endorsement


In 2021, the popularity of Dogecoin reached new heights when Tesla CEO Elon Musk began to tweet about the cryptocurrency. Musk's tweets, often accompanied by playful Dogecoin references, drew attention to the coin and helped it gain mainstream recognition. Musk's endorsement gave Dogecoin a significant boost, increasing its value and bringing it to the attention of a wider audience.

The Utility of Dogecoin


While Dogecoin started as a joke, it has gradually gained utility. Its low transaction fees and fast processing times make it suitable for micro-transactions and online payments. Dogecoin is also increasingly being accepted as payment by businesses and organizations, including online retailers, coffee shops, and even charities.
